Image resolution refers to the number of pixels displayed on the screen, determining the clarity and detail of the visuals. Higher resolutions enhance the viewer's experience by providing sharper images, especially important for digital signage where visual impact is key.

Brightness in digital signage determines how well the display can be seen in various lighting conditions, ensuring the visibility and effectiveness of the content presented. Selecting the right brightness level is crucial for maintaining clarity and impact, especially in environments with different lighting intensities.
